What to Expect

In Complots, you control two hidden characters with unique powers, aiming to eliminate your opponents through bluffing, manipulation, and strategic play. Set in a corrupt city vying for power, each turn lets you take actions like collecting coins, assassinating opponents, or blocking attacks, all while trying to guess who holds which character. The game combines tension and player interaction in quick 15-minute rounds.

How It Works

Each player starts with two face-down character cards and two coins. On your turn, you can perform actions linked to character abilities or general moves like income or coup, regardless of your actual cards, introducing bluff elements. Mechanics include Memory, Player Elimination, and Variable Player Powers, creating dynamic and interactive gameplay where the goal is to eliminate all other players.

What Makes It Special

Designed by Rikki Tahta, Complots is a variant of Coup, featuring an additional character, the Inquisitor, and variable player abilities. It mixes bluffing and deduction in a fast-paced card game. The game also has a digital implementation on Board Game Arena, expanding its accessibility.
